Eden Hazard is not a huge fan of individual accolades; he’s a team-first, pass-first kind of guy, often to his own detriment. But on his goal against Arsenal, he literally had no one to pass to, so he decided to simply take on half the visiting Gunners at Stamford Bridge and score what will sure be one of the favorites for goal of the season at the end of the year.
As it stands, it’s the Goal of the Month in the Premier League for February.

“It is always good to win trophies. It is not my most important target to win Goal of the Month, I want to win big trophies at the end of the season, but it is something I can say in few years.”
“It means a lot for the fans and for us, because it was a derby and we won the game. That is the most important thing in football, that you win the game if you score a fantastic goal, and I hope to score more goals like this.”
-Eden Hazard; source: Chelsea FC
